Description

A tall, narrow ancestor face crowned by a smooth domed helmet — quiet, stylised and a little otherworldly. This mask is strongly vertical: a rounded, split cap rises over a long slender face with a high flat brow, deep-set slit eyes, a straight ridged nose and a small carved mouth on a jutting chin. The forms are pared right back to planes and gentle curves, giving it that carved-hardwood, low-poly tribal look reminiscent of West African and Pacific-island ceremonial pieces. There is no clutter — just the calm geometry of the face and the clean seam running up the crown. It is meant as wall art: a striking, minimalist piece for a hallway, studio or gallery wall, and an easy statement print for anyone who likes ethnographic or brutalist-leaning decor. Print notes • Print it face-up and flat on the back if the reverse is hollow or open; otherwise stand it upright and it will need only light supports under the chin and nose overhang. • The broad smooth cheeks show every layer line, so drop to 0.12mm and keep part cooling steady for an even finish. • Scale it up — this design carries well at 200mm+ where the planes read as bold shadow shapes on a wall. • After printing, a matte earth-brown or aged-bronze rattle-can finish, lightly dry-brushed, sells the carved-wood or cast-metal illusion. Add a keyhole slot or a pair of magnets to the back before slicing so it hangs flush and flat.
